China strongly supports Pakistan and maintains a deeply adversarial and competitive relationship with India.
"Iron Brotherhood" with Pakistan: China and Pakistan are close strategic allies. China is Pakistan’s largest arms supplier, providing advanced military hardware (such as J-10C fighter jets) and technical support. Beijing also heavily invests in Pakistan’s economy and infrastructure through the China-Pakistan Economic Corridor.
Lingering Sino-Indian border tensions, stemming from the deadly 2020 Galwan Valley skirmishes and ongoing military build-ups along the Line of Actual Control (LAC), continue to be a primary driver of nationalist friction.
China and India share a massive, highly militarized border in the Himalayas. The two countries have engaged in deadly military standoffs, and China actively opposes India's regional influence. The article’s framing appears misleading and irresponsible. It presents an old Indian fake-degree case as an “H-1B fraud bust,” yet it does not provide official evidence showing that the seized degrees were used in H-1B petitions or that this was a U.S. immigration enforcement action.
A serious article making claims about visa fraud should cite credible sources such as USCIS, DOJ, ICE, the Department of Labor, court filings, or named enforcement actions. This piece does not appear to do that. Instead, it uses charged H-1B language in the headline and article without clearly substantiating the connection.
It risks misleading readers, inflaming anti-immigrant sentiment, and presenting recycled or unrelated material as if it were a current H-1B scandal.
